Why a local agent topics whilst the water is your neighbour
On paper, two apartments can appearance similar, exact all the way down to square meterage and look at hall. In individual, one catches the southeasterly like a sail and stays 2 to a few tiers cooler in summer devoid of competitive air con. Another suffers from afternoon glare that makes the balcony usable simply prior to 10 a.m. A regional agent who has walked the ones balconies in January can inform you which stack is the candy spot and which one sits in a wind tunnel whilst storms push across from the Great Barrier Reef.
There are additional subtleties. In Cairns North, older constructions sometimes convey larger body company prices to fund carry replacements and facade upkeep in the salt-laden air. In Freshwater and Stratford, houses toward the Barron River apartments could also be in better flood-chance different types, impacting insurance coverage. Properties close the airport flight path balance trip comfort with occasional noise, and an experienced agent will comprehend the runway usage styles and which streets have the least impression. Waterfront is extraordinary, yet this can be the tropics. The accurate information continues a postcard subculture from turning into a spreadsheet of surprises.

Inspections in the tropics: what to examine and what to accept
Salt air and humidity scan every construction. Steel balustrades, corrugated roofing screws, exterior door hardware, aircon coils, and ceiling paint in excessive-humidity zones deserve close focus. On the ground, you can actually pay attention the blunt advice: think the setting will win except you care for it. A constructing that looks pristine from the road may conceal a body company records of habitual facade re-sealing, which is unquestionably a favorable signal. It means the sinking fund is getting used right and the committee is lively.
At the condo degree, cross-ventilation topics as plenty as insulation. Louvres are not just aesthetic here, they are a standard of living mechanism. A well-sited Trinity Beach domicile that cradles the breeze can experience dramatically greater mushy than a larger yet poorly orientated condominium in the related value band. Again, an agent who spends time in those houses for the time of the most well liked weeks includes lifelike intelligence you possibly can borrow.
The condominium graphic: yields, occupancy, and management reality
Waterfront and close to-water stock splits among long-term residential and short-dwell vacation lets. In the CBD and Esplanade precincts, the vacation pool can supply pleasing headline yields at some point of top months, however you will have to mannequin lifelike occupancy across the yr. Take a two-bedroom, water-view house in a serviced difficult within going for walks distance of the Reef Hotel Casino and the Convention Centre. In high season, eighty to 90 percent occupancy is viable at fit nightly costs. Across the total 12 months, modify that to the fifty five to 70 percent vary relying on leadership, critiques, and calendar area.
North alongside the seashores, brief-reside can do o.k. in Palm Cove, which reward from wedding industry and greater nightly rates, however body corporate by-legal guidelines and council policies need to be checked line by line. Trinity Beach and Kewarra Beach see steadier family members bookings. If you desire much less volatility, long-term tenancies close to hospitals, TAFE, and the airport precinct furnish strong demand. An agent with equally income and assets leadership experience can train you which ones constructions defend ninety five % occupancy throughout cycles and which depend upon height-season sugar highs that flatten the relax of the 12 months.
Financing and assurance with eyes open
Coastal lending in Queensland is easy while the fundamentals are sound, yet creditors and insurers look demanding at flood overlays, constructing age, and production constituents. A top-upward push condo with a amazing sinking fund and latest engineering reviews could be a dream to finance. A fascinating yet older low-upward push without documented maintenance can cause valuation haircuts. For homes, insurers will expense danger situated on proximity to waterways, floor height, and constructing codes on the time of construction. This is the place a regional agent’s report kit saves days. Expect them to tug body corporate mins for the last 2 to a few years, proof of accomplished works, and title any unapproved structures prior to you spend on agreement lawyers.

Practical steps to get your search right
Here is a functional, targeted listing that you can use as you interact the market and your agent.
- Write a one-web page transient that includes ought to-haves, superb-to-haves, coverage tolerance, and your most likely usage development across wet and dry seasons. Ask your agent for the final two years of physique company minutes, plus latest sinking fund balances, for each brief-indexed belongings. Inspect at two times of day, ideally morning and late afternoon, to evaluate breeze, glare, and balcony usability. Price look at various with apartment managers: get two autonomous projections if you happen to intend short-keep or lengthy-term leasing. Confirm flood overlays, elevation data, and preservation histories sooner than you spend on a contract review.
